Mela Patterson

June 28, 1928 — October 24, 2025

Manuelita Patterson, known lovingly to all as Mela, passed away peacefully on Friday, October 24, 2025, surrounded by her loved ones, at the age of 97.

She was preceded in death by her parents Ramon and Regina Lopez; sisters: Terry Romero, Isabel Ortega, Chris Nolan; brother Ramond Lopez; and grandson Keith Patterson.

Mela is survived by her son Raymond Patterson and his wife Pamela; daughter Rita Montano and her husband Phil; along with two grandsons, two granddaughters, four great-granddaughters, five great-grandsons, two great-great-granddaughters, as well as numerous nieces and nephews.

Mela was known for her warm spirit and humble nature. Faith was the cornerstone of Mela’s life, and as a devoted Catholic, she found strength, comfort, and community within her church. She served through acts of service and kindness, embodying the true spirit of love, generosity, and humility.

Mela leaves behind a legacy defined by warmth, kindness, hospitality, and a zest for life. She filled her years with friendship, joy, and countless cherished memories. Her family and friends will forever treasure her gentle heart, her laughter, and the grace with which she lived her life. She will be deeply missed by all who had the privilege of knowing her.
